Margaret Skaggs of Campbellsville, daughter of the late Rhodie Cecil and Bennita Fogel Cecil, was
born in Marion County, Kentucky, June 3, 1923. She died at 10:50 P.M., Sunday, September 4, 2011, in Campbellsville.
Age:   88

She was a member of the Our Lady of Perpetual Help Catholic Church.

She is survived by her husband, Raymond J. Skaggs of Campbellsville; two daughters and three sons: Delores Pruitt, Rosemary Pinson, and James R. Borders of Campbellsville and
Theodore R. Borders, Jr. and Charles Timothy Borders of Louisville; one step-daughter, Paula Hawkins of Louisville; thirteen grandchildren; twenty-five great-grandchildren; one step-grandson; one step-great-granddaughter; one sister and one brother: Mary Aileen Yates of Louisville and William Cecil of Indiana; several other relatives and many friends.

She was preceded in death by two sons: Michael Allen Borders and John David Borders; one granddaughter, Lisabeth Pruitt; one sister and two brothers: Mary Frances Schuhmann, Joseph
Cecil, and Leon Cecil.
